Application
Immunofluorescence microscopy of cells in culture (Bumoi et al., 1984; Schrappe et al., 1992). Also, Legg J et al (2003) Development 130:6049-6063 {3% PFA fixed frozen sections}.
Immunoelectron microscopy (Bumoi et al., 1984)
Immunoprecipitation: 1µg/10E6 cells (Bumoi et al., 1984; Morgan et al., 1981)
FACS analysis: 1-2µg/10E6 cells
Functional block of melanoma cell spreading (Morgan et al., 1981), glioma cell proliferation3 and tumor growth in nude mice (Morgan et al., 1981; Schrappe et al., 1992).
Optimal working dilutions must be determined by end user.

Immunogen
Human M14 melanoma cell extract depleted of fibronectin and bound by lens culinaris lectin-Sepharose™ (Morgan et al., 1981).

Specificity
Recognizes mature chondroitin sulfate proteoglycan core glycoprotein of 250 kDa as well as precursor polypeptides of 210, 220 and 240 kDa (Bumoi et al., 1984). Reacts with human melanoma, glioma and proliferating brain endothelial cells.
